        Factors that influence participation of youth in church growth and development: A case study of Runogone Circuit, Kaaga synod 

        Kagwiria, Mutua Catherine (KeMU, 2012-06)
        The. purpose of the study was to identify, psychosocial factors that influence the participation of the youth in church growth and development. The world we are living in today has brought a lot of changes in human life ...
